I applied via Campus Placement and was interviewed in Sep 2024. There were 2 interview rounds.

Round 1 - Aptitude Test 

Psychometric test , it was kind of game

Round 2 - Group Discussion 

Group of 8 members and topic was based on the company

I applied via Campus Placement

Round 1 - Resume Shortlist 
Pro Tip by AmbitionBox:
Keep your resume crisp and to the point. A recruiter looks at your resume for an average of 6 seconds, make sure to leave the best impression.
View all Resume tips
Round 2 - Aptitude Test 

Aptitude was of medium level. Some basic practice would help.

Round 3 - Technical 

(1 Question)

  • Q1. Written test based on the core mechanical subjects. Thermodynamics was more focused, along with fluid machines.
Round 4 - One-on-one 

(3 Questions)

  • Q1. Question based on refrigeration, its working, its basic concepts
  • Q2. Types of pumps, itss working , some practical questions.
  • Q3. Question on projects done

Interview Preparation Tips

Interview preparation tips for other job seekers - Brush up the basics concepts of engineering, based on the some practical questions would be asked. Stay calm and answer.
